The reinforced brick masonry consists of brick masonry which has Steel … WebWhere an alternative reinforced masonry system is proposed as a Performance Solution to that described in Part 3.3.2, that proposal must comply with— Performance Requirement … WebMar 27, 2007 · The primary components of a reinforced masonry system are the masonry units, grout, mortar, and reinforcement. The masonry units, grout, and mortar resist compressive stresses. Generally, the reinforcement (horizontal and vertical) protects against only tension stresses. WebOur product line consists of high quality systems for masonry including truss and ladder masonry reinforcement designs, stone Anchors, veneer Anchors, partition top anchors, … WebIn reinforced masonry, grout bonds the masonry units and reinforcing steel so that they act together to resist imposed loads. In partially grouted walls, grout is placed only in wall spaces containing steel reinforcement. When all cores, with or without reinforcement, are grouted, the wall is considered solidly grouted. WebReinforced concrete (RC) jackets technique for strengthening of masonry structure consists of application of jackets on one or both sides of masonry walls. This method is used for brick masonry as well as for stone masonry walls. For using reinforcement jackets, first the plaster is removed from the walls.
